Monday, 10 July 2023 Delhi recorded 153 mm rain in 24 hours ending at 8:30 am on Sunday, the highest in a single day in July since 1982, the India Meteorological Department (IMD) said.
The water level of Yamuna in Delhi breached the danger mark. The rive is now hovering at 206.24 metres while the danger mark is at 205.33 metres.
